POSITION SUMMARY:              

Responsible for providing general financial aid knowledge and overviews to new, continuing, and returning students.  Develop, negotiate and finalize student financial plans consistent with financial planning policies and procedures and with Federal/State regulations for awarding aid. Explain and guide students and parents through the application process, including verification, conflicting information, and C Code Resolution.  Counsel students on all acceptances and other matters related directly to the student financial plan.

 

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S:

The following duties are representative of the essential responsibilities of this position. Additional duties may be assigned.

 

  1. Work cohesively with Admission Representative in order to facilitate outstanding service to prospective students and their parents. 
  2. Efficiently and accurately package assigned students including includes new, continuing, re-entry and transfer students.
  3. Guide students on the financial aid process, including required forms, documents, and process.  
  4. Create financial plans for assigned students in compliance with institutional policies and Federal regulations, communicate the plan to students and parents, and effectively explain rights and responsibilities for each aid source.
  5. Assist students and parents with alternative means of financing any remaining balance after awarding eligible federal, state, or institutional aid
  6. Ensure student files are complete and accurate and that aid is paid to students’ accounts in a timely manner.
  7. Review ISIRs, request outstanding documents, and perform all levels of verification and C Code reviews. 
  8. Utilize reports to review students, analyze work needed, ability to prioritize daily workload independently prioritize workload.  
  9. Strong Customer Service, ability to calm students and parents, accurately articulate the status of a student’s aid and account.
  10. Complete the appropriate training modules within 30 days of the new or revised module becoming available.
  11. Assist with or perform special projects as assigned. Other duties as assigned

 

REQUIRED QUALIFICATIONS:

  • Bachelor’s degree in a related discipline or Associate’s Degree and 3 years of related experience with federal and student financial aid, or 5 years of related experience with federal and student aid. 
  • Financial aid or accounting experience required.
  • Customer service, problem-solving experience required. 
  • Excellent communication and interpersonal skills. 
  • Ability to make small group presentations as well as skill in interacting on a one on one basis.
  • The ability to multi-task, work independently, and make decisions based on guidelines.
  • Strong basic computer software (MS Office) skills as well as exposure to more concentrated financial aid software (Campus Vue/Campus Nexus preferred)
